(1) If Charlotte is in Paris under the Eifel Tower, then she is in France.

Social Studies
1 answer:
Crank3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

Modus Ponens

Explanation:

This way of deduction is a clear example of a Modus Ponens, which is a mechanism used to achieve conclusions and deductions from the given information using an implicit way. In this specific example, it is possible to notice that the in the first part of the given the information, it is only mentioned that Charlotte is in Paris under the Eifel Tower, therefore, it can be concluded that Charlotte is in France, even if it is not directly mentioned in the sentence, due to the fact that it is possible to infer that the city of Paris is located in France.

How do attachments to the "fruits of desire" bind one to the cycle of samsara and the "problem" of Hinduism?
Ostrovityanka [42]

Answer:

A person should never be passionately attached to the fruits of desire or else he will be enslaved. So, when he cannot satisfy his desire, he will become angry and in this way, <u>his soul will be concealed and his intelligent-will will be destroyed.</u> His soul will then become<em> inactive.</em>

Explanation:

"Reincarnation" refers to a soul's rebirth into a new body. This involves a process called <em>"samsara," </em>which is a<em> cycle of death and rebirth.</em>

As people live through life's different stages, they encounter certain desires. In Hinduism, such desires are normal and should<u> never be suppressed.</u> They should, however, be fulfilled through fair play and prudence. The "fruits of desire" can only be achieved if the person pursues his desire <u>without greed.</u> In this way, he'll be able to enjoy the fruits of desire.

Reynaldo has an irrational fear of cats and has all the symptoms of a phobia. Knowing that some behavioral techniques are effect
user100 [1]

Answer: the correct answer is (C) In vivo exposure

Explanation:

In vivo exposure is a kind of exposure therapy, generally used for treating individuals with phobias, obsessive-compulsive disorder, and other anxiety disorders.
